NATIONAL EUCHARISTIC CONGRESS: Will take place at Knock Shrine from 26th to 27th September on the theme ‘Christ, our Hope’. A bus from Kanturk will travel on Saturday 26th leaving at 7am. For more information contact Betty on 087-2572064 or Ellen on 086-3709691.

GRANDPARENTS PILGRIMAGE: Will take place at Knock Shrine on Sunday 13th September commencing at 2.30pm with anointing of the sick followed by mass at 3pm.
